Job Title: Senior Manager, Business Development

Company: CX, a Connor Group Company

CX, a Connor Group Company, is hiring a Senior Manager of Business Development in Dallas, Texas and Las Vegas, Nevada to support growth. This role focuses on building CX’s presence in the marketplace by leveraging existing relationships, developing new connections, and partnering closely with market leaders to drive revenue. The role centers on identifying opportunities, cultivating client relationships, and converting leads into long-term engagements with companies across various stages.

Key Responsibilities

• Identify, cultivate, and close new client opportunities while expanding relationships with existing clients.

• Build and maintain a strong client pipeline across the CX service line, primarily in the accounting and finance interim staffing space.

• Develop and manage relationships with executives such as CFOs, VPs, Controllers, and other senior leaders at mid-market to large companies.

• Prospect and engage potential clients through meetings, networking events, industry conferences, and targeted outreach.

• Develop and grow a strong referral ecosystem including Big 4 firms, mid-tier public accounting firms, private equity, and other strategic partners.

• Work closely with CX leadership to support regional market development and achieve quarterly and annual sales goals.

• Prepare and coordinate client-facing documentation including NDAs, engagement letters, statements of work, and responses to client requests.

• Lead and organize regional events to support brand awareness and client engagement.

• Stay informed on market activity, emerging companies, and potential client needs in order to identify and pursue new opportunities.

  • Provide engagement leadership across active clients, including regular check-ins with both client stakeholders and CX teams, coordinating performance reviews, gathering and delivering feedback, and proactively identifying opportunities to expand or deepen client engagements.
  • Maintain disciplined and timely activity within the CRM, ensuring accurate pipeline tracking, forecasting, and visibility into client interactions and deal progression.

Target Client Profile

• Private and public companies ranging from approximately $50M to $5B in revenue

• Industries may include oil & gas, gaming, technology, construction, life sciences, and other emerging sectors

Preferred Qualifications

• 8-15 years of relevant experience in business development, sales, consulting, or accounting services

• Team-oriented operator who collaborates across regions and shares opportunities to maximize client impact

• Established professional network, particularly with CFOs, company executives, VPs of Finance, and Controllers

• Demonstrated ability to build and maintain strong client and partner relationships

• Strong communication and presentation skills with the ability to represent the CX brand effectively

• High integrity and strong professional presence

• Self-driven, ambitious, and comfortable operating in a relationship-focused sales environment

• CRM experience preferred

About Connor Group

Connor Group is built for breakthroughs.

We’re a professional services firm focused on the most critical challenges for ambitious companies and their opportunities to shatter the status quo.

We serve the offices of the CFO, CIO/CTO, and CHRO as leaders in:

• AI & Advanced Automation

• Technology Implementation

• Accounting Advisory

• Financial Close & Reporting

• Transformation & Risk

• M&A Transaction Services

• IPO Services

We’re trusted by over 2,000 of the most exciting brands on earth to deliver results that last.

Trusted because we’re different.

Founded in 2006, Connor Group quickly became the leading IPO advisory firm. Helping over 265 companies go public built our pragmatic, delivery-oriented approach and $4.0 trillion (and counting) in client valuation.

It also created elite-level pattern recognition and listening skills to identify problems quickly and solve them efficiently.

The majority of Connor Group has industry experience. We know how to get things done. Expect tailored, real-world solutions and sleeves rolled up.

Our expert teams are fluent in function, technology, and world-class communication.
